Overview
Skills
Job Details
Location: New York, NY 10170 (Onsite)
Duration: 12 Months (37.5 hrs/week)
Seeking a seasoned Senior iOS Developer (10+ years) to join the client's enterprise team in New York City. This role offers the opportunity to own end-to-end iOS application design and development, collaborate with business stakeholders, and deliver high-performance, secure, and scalable apps.
What You'll Do-
Lead design and development of enterprise-grade iOS apps using Swift, SwiftUI, and Objective-C.
-
Migrate, modernize, and optimize legacy code for performance and maintainability.
-
Work on Core/Swift Data, persistent stores, concurrency (GCD), and operational queues.
-
Integrate APIs, payment gateways, Firebase, and cloud technologies (AWS, Azure, Google Cloud Platform).
-
Collaborate with product, QA, and backend teams to deliver robust solutions.
-
Conduct unit testing, code reviews, and maintain strong documentation.
-
Mentor junior developers and foster team collaboration.
-
10+ years iOS development experience.
-
Bachelor's degree or higher in Computer Science or related field.
-
Deep expertise in Xcode, Instruments, Swift, SwiftUI, Objective-C, MVC/MVVM design patterns.
-
Strong knowledge of UI/UX design, Git, cloud platforms, and debugging.
-
Hands-on with CI/CD tools, Firebase integration, and JSON parsing.
-
Excellent communication, problem-solving, and leadership skills.
-
Bonus: Experience with C++, PHP, .Net, C#, JavaScript, Oracle SQL, or AI tools.
-
Competitive rates
-
Opportunity to work on high-impact enterprise apps
-
Long-term 12-month project with potential extension.
-
Work alongside a collaborative, innovative team.
Apply now if you're an experienced iOS engineer ready to take ownership, drive innovation, and deliver world-class mobile experiences!